Today's guest is the amazing Elise Lovejoy: educator, illustrator, publisher and mother to two excellent kids that I have had the pleasure of doing parkour with at the Griffith Observatory in LA.
In this episode, Elise talks about her very deliberate walking out of her comfort zone, her linguistic gaffes in Mexico, what drove her to establish her publishing company, Express Readers, and what she likes doing in her spare time (as if THAT'S a thing haha!).
